Цифровое устройство измерения времени

Номер патента: 767691

Авторы: Соколов, Токарев

ZIP архив

Текст

ОПИСАНИЕИЗОБРЕТЕНИЯК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 Союз Советских Социалистических Республик(22) Заявлено 190678 (21) 2 б 32520/18-10с присоединением заявки йо(51)М (лз С 04 Г 10/00 Государственный комитет СССР по делам изобретений и открытий(088. 8) Дата опубликования описания 3009.80(71) Заявитель 54) ЦИФРОВОЕ УСТРОЙСТВО ИЗМЕРЕНИЯ ВРЕМЕНИится к областиастности, к уст-ремени, использу - электронатор тактооты, счет- генератор управле- ИЛИ, по- переключаные вой чик е 5 ся зодерные О Изобретение относприборостроения, в чройствам измерения вемым в ЭВМ,Известен датчик временичасы, содержащий генерчастоты, делитель частминут, счетчик часов,установки времени, триггерния, элементы И, элементытенциометр и двухполюсныйтель 1) .Наиболее близким по техническойсущности к описываемому изобретениявляется цифровое устройство измерния времени, содержащее последовательно соединенные генератор, делитель частоты, двоичные счетчики секунд, минут ичасов, формирователиотметок времени и блок контроля 2)Недостатком этого устройства является невозможность работы с внешними устройствами.Цель изобретения - расщирениефункциональных возможностей устройсва за счет увеличения видов передаваемой информации.Поставленная цель достигает асчет того, что в устройство, сжащее последовательно соединен генератор стабильной частоты, делйтель частоты, двоичные счетчики секунд, минут и часов, к цепям переноса которых подключены входы формирователей отметок времени, и блок контроля, входы которого подключены квыходам формирователей отметок времени, введены блок упрйвления, блоканализа команд, счетчик переданныхбайтов, блок выработки байтов, состояния, мультиплексор, блок установки монопольного режима, детектор отметок времени, счетчик опОвещения ирегистр текущего времени. При этомвыход блока управления подключен ковходу блока анализа команд, первыйвыход .которого подключен ко второмувходу блока установки монопольногорежима, а второй выход - к первомУвходу блока выработки байтов состояния, ко второму входу которого - выход блока контроля, а к третьему входу подключены выход счетчика переданных байтов и третий вход мультиплексора, к первому входу которого подсоединен выход блока выработки байтовсостояния, а выход мультиплексора -к первому входу блока управления,второй вход которого соединен с первым выходом блока установки монопольного режима. При этом первый входсчетчика переданных байтов соединенсо вторым выходом детектора отметоквремени, входы которого подключены квыходам формирователей отметок секунд, минут и часов, первый выход детектора - стретьим входом блока установки монопольного режима, а второйвыход подключен ко второму входу счетчикапереданных байтов, Кроме того,вы од формирователя секундных отметок соединен с первым входом счетчикаоповещения, выход которого подключенк первому входу блока установки монопольного режима, а три входа регистратекущего времени - соответственно свыходами счетчиков секунд, минут ичасов. Четвертый вход регистра соединен со вторым выходом детектоРаотметок времени, пятый вход с третьим,выходом блока установки монопольного режиМа, а выход регистра соединен сЬ вторым входом мультиплексоРае"тру 1 турная схема устройства представлена на чертеже,Устройство состоит из генератора1 стабильной частоты, делителя 2 частоты, двоичного счетчика 3 секунд,двоичногс счетчика 4 минут, двоичного счетчика 5 часов, регистра б текушего времени формирователя 7 секундных отметок, формирователя 8 минутных отметок, формирователя 9 часовых отметок, блока 10 контроля,блока 11 управления,блока 12 анализа,команд, счетчика 13 переданных байтов, детектора 14 отметок времени,блока 15 выработки байтов состояния,счетчика 16 оповещения, мультиплексора 17, блока 18 установки монопольного режима,При этом в устройстве последовательносоединены генератор 1 стабильной частоты, делитель 2 частоты идвоичные счетчики секунд, минут ичасов (соответствеццо 3, 4 и 5). Кцепям перецоса этих блоков подключены формирователи)7, 8, 9 отметок времени. Выходы счетчико 3, 4, 5 сбе-дйн ены с;".е р зьп 4 р вт срым и трд т ьи мвходами регистра 6, Выходы формирователей 7, 89 под.лючецы ко входамблока 10 коцтроля и детектора 14 отметок, Выход блока 1 онтроля - ко втоРому входу блока 15 выработки байтовсостояния. Вход счетчика 16 оповещения соединен с выходом секундной отметки, а выход этого, счетчика - спервым входом блока установки моцо-польного режима. Первый выход детек. тора отметок соединен с третьим входом блока 18 установки монопольногорежима, а второй выход детектора -с четвертым входом регистра 6 и спервым входом счетчика 13 переданныхбайтов, Третий вход 19 и второй выход 20 блока 11 Управления присоеди - ,няются к минам канала. Первый и зто рой входы блока управления соединенысоответственно с выходом мультиплек-,сора 17 и с первым выходом блока 18установки монопольного режима. Выходблока управления соединен со входомблока 12 анализа команд, первый выход блока 12 - с вторым входом блокаустановки монопольного режима, второйвыход блока 12 - с первым входом бло-ка 15 выработки байтов состояния,Второй и третий выходы блока 18 установки монопольного режима связаны со-ответственно с вторым входом счетчика 13 и с пятым входом регистра 6,Выход счетчика 13 соедини с третьимвходом блока 15 выработки байтов сос тояния и с третьим входом мультиплексора 17.Цифровое устройство работает следующим образом.Поступающий от канала по шинам 19 20 адрес внешнего устройства з блокеуправления сравнивается с адресом,присвоенным датчику времени, Принесовпадении адресов сигнал Выборка каналапередается по цинам 20другим внешним устройствам, Присовпадении адресов совершается логическое подключение устройствак каналу (з канал выдается ответныйадрес устройства и сигналРаботаабо н ецт а) . Проан ализ иро в ав сообщение, канал продолжает начальнуювыборку выдачей команды. Блок 12анэли:да команд запоминает ее и выявляет з ней признак чтения, Темвременем дается разрешение на выдачу нулевого байта состояния, которыйпо цепи из блоков 15, 17 и 11 направ. ляется в канал по шинам 20. Принявнулевой байт, канал дает разрешениена прием временной информации, цво ичный код текущего времени постоянноформируется в счетчиках 3-5, а отмет.-,ки времени - з формирователях 7-9,Код поступает в регистр б текущеговремени, где фиксируется в подразде ленин на байты секунд, минут и часов.Смена кода в регистре б происходит,как правило, по мере смены его всчетчи 1 ах, Отметки времени поступаютв блоки 10 и 14.Блок 10 осуществляет непрерывныйконтроль за выработкой отметок. Блок14 спедит за"порядком поступления от-,меток - с тем, чтобы организоватьпо запросу из канала выдачу необходимого числа байтов времени, а также 55 вспомогательного байта для регистра-ции числа переданных байтов. При по 1ступлении первой командычит атьвоз буждается блок 18, который поддерживает сигналработа абонемента- признак монопольного режимана время передачи у через блок 11 онпередается в канал, В блоке 18 вырабатывается также импульс блокировкидля регистра б, чтобы содержимое посл днего не изменялось во время пере-,0 15 20 30 35 40 50 60 дачи, В этом регистре, помимо байтоввремени, хранится поступившее из детектора чйсло 4, т.е. признак о выдаче из регистра 6 всех байтов (секунд,минут, часов и вспомогательного байта), Байты передаются в канал из регистра б через мультиплексор 17 иблок 11, Число 4 заносится также ввычитающий счетчик 13 Из блока 18начинают поступать счетные импульсы.После передачи каждого байта число в счетчике 13 уменьшается наединицу. В рассматриваемом случае передается пакет из четырех байтов; После очистки счетчика блокировка с регистра б снимается и его содержимоеобновляется, Блок 15 формирует и передает в канал байт состояния с указателями внешнее устройство кончилоиканал кончил , Сигнал 1 Работа абонентасбрасывается. В дальнейшем выдача информации зависит оттого, насколько часто приходит из канала командачитать. Детектор 14отметок постоянно анализирует, какаянаиболее длиннопериодная - старшаяотметка зарегистрирована завремя между командами. Если какстаршая зарегистрирована часовая отметка, то работа идет в изложеннойпоследовательности и в канал поступает пакет из четырех байтбв, Если какстаршая зарегистрирована минутная отметка,то в канал выдаются только байты секунд и минут, а также вспомогательный байт с числом 3, поступающийиз детектора. Тем самым канал получает указание о том, что переданный ранее байт часов не устарел. Если какстаршая зарегистирована секундная отметка, то выдаются байт секунд ивспомогательный байт с числом 2, Таким образом, всякий раз выдаются байты, характеризующие приращение времени, В соответствии с числом передаваемых байтов блок 14 заносит число 2, 3 или 4 в регистр б и в счетчик 13, После очистки счетчика всякий раз выдается байт состояния суказателями внешнее устройствокончило и каналкончил,При возникновении сбоя в устройстве сигнал ошибки из блока 10 поступает в блок 15, После этого в блоке 15 формируется байт состоянияс указателем ошибка в устройстве,а также необходимые байты уточенного состояния они могут быть считаны каналом по команде уточнить состояние). Все байты, выдаваемыеустройством, проходят через мультиплексор 17.Для устройства может быть такжеустановлен режим, когда оно является инициатором связи с каналом ввода-вывода (например, для ежечаснойпередачи в канал кода текущего времени), За 1 с до насутпления целогочаса счетчиком 16 оповещения оформ/ 1 ляется вызов для связи с каналом;блоком 11 управления выставляется на выходе 20 сигнал требование абонента., а послеразрешения выборки каналом в " работа абонента и адрес устройства, В блоке 15 формируется байт состояния с указателем внимание, Байт считывается каналом по команде проверить ввод-вывод, За счет. сигнала работа абонента устройство устанавливает монопольный режим передачи.Таким образом, введение в датчик времени блока управления, блока анализа команд, счетчика переданных байтов, блока выработки байтов состояния, мультиплексора, блока установки монопольного режима, детектора. отметок времени, счетчика оповещения и регистра текущего времени и расши- ряет функциональные воэможности устройства за счет увеличения объема передаваемой информации и числа ее потребителей. Формула изобретенияЦифровое устройство измерения времени содержащее последовательно соединенные генератор, делитель ча:тоты, двоичные счетчики секунд, минут и часов, формирователи отметок времени и блок контроля, поичем ко входам двоичных счетчиков секунд, минут и часбв подключены входы соответствующих формирователей отметок времени, выходы которых соединены со входами блока контроля, о т л и ч а ю щ е ес я тем, что, с целью расширения функциональных возможностей за счет увеличения видов передаваемой информации, в него введены блок управления, блок анализа команд, счетчик переданных байтов, блок выработки байтов состояния, мультиплексор, блок установки монопольного режима, детектор отметок времени, счетчик оповещения и регистр текущего времени, причем выход блока управления подключен ко входу блока анализа команд первый выход которого подключен ко второму входу блока установки монопольного режима, а второй выход подключен к первому входу блока выработки байтов состояния, ко второму входу которого - выход блока контроля, а к третьему входу подключены выход счетчика переданных байтов и третий вход мультиплексора, к первому входу которого подключен вы" ход блока выработки байтов состояния, а выход мультиплексора - к первому входу блока управления, второй вход которого соединен с первым выходом блока установки монопольного режима, при атом первый вход счетчика переданных байтов соединен со вторым выходом детектора отметок времени,767691 с Корректор Ю,Макарен акт ираж 482сударственного комитета Сизобретений и открытийва, Ж, Раушская наб., д одпис 7191/42ВНИИПИпо дел113035, Мо Зака ППатент, г. Ужгород, ул, Проектная Фи входы которого. подключены к ходформирователей отметок секунд, минути часов, первый выход детектора соединен с третьим входом блока установки монопольного режима, а второй выход подключен ко второму входу счетчика переданных байтов, кроме того,выход формирователя секундных отметок соединен с первым входом счетчика оповещения, выход которого подключен к первому входу блока установкимойопольного режима, а три входа регистра текущего времени соединенысоответственно с выходами счетчиков Составитель И. Слосекунд, минут и часов, четвертыйвход регистра соединен со вторым вы-.ходом детектора отметок времени, пятый вход - с третьим выходом блокаустановки монопольного режима,а выход регистра соединен со вторым входом мультиплексора.Источники информации,принятые во внимание при экспертизе1. Авторское свидетельство СССРР 566230, кл, 6 04 С, 3/00, 02,03.762, Авторское свидетельство СССРР 419836, кл. 0 04 Р 10/04, 06.05,71

Смотреть

Заявка

2632520, 19.06.1978

ПРЕДПРИЯТИЕ ПЯ Р-6380

СОКОЛОВ ЮРИЙ ЛЕОНИДОВИЧ, ТОКАРЕВ БОРИС АЛЕКСАНДРОВИЧ

МПК / Метки

МПК: G04F 10/00

Метки: времени, цифровое

Опубликовано: 30.09.1980

Код ссылки

<a href="https://patents.su/4-767691-cifrovoe-ustrojjstvo-izmereniya-vremeni.html" target="_blank" rel="follow" title="База патентов СССР">Цифровое устройство измерения времени</a>

Похожие патенты